How to change the color of check marks in WhatsApp - briefly?
To change the color of checkmarks in WhatsApp, you need to use a third-party app called "WhatsApp Mods" or similar. These apps allow users to customize various aspects of the WhatsApp interface, including checkmark colors. However, it's important to note that using such modifications may violate WhatsApp's terms of service and could potentially lead to account suspension.
How to change the color of check marks in WhatsApp - in detail?
Changing the color of checkmarks in WhatsApp can be a personalized way to enhance your messaging experience. Unfortunately, WhatsApp does not natively support changing the color of checkmarks through its standard settings. However, there are alternative methods that users employ to achieve this customization.
One common approach is using third-party applications or tweaks designed for jailbroken iOS devices or rooted Android phones. These apps allow users to modify various aspects of WhatsApp's interface, including checkmark colors.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how you can achieve this:
For Jailbroken iOS Devices:
- Jailbreak Your Device: If your iPhone is not already jailbroken, you will need to do so using tools like Chimera or unc0ver. Be cautious and ensure you understand the risks involved.
- Install a Tweak: Once your device is jailbroken, search for tweaks that allow WhatsApp customization in repositories such as Cydia or Sileo. Popular options include "WhatsApp++" or "ColorMyWhats".
- Configure the Tweak: After installing the tweak, open it and navigate to the settings where you can change the color of checkmarks. Follow the on-screen instructions to apply your desired color scheme.
For Rooted Android Devices:
- Root Your Device: If your Android phone is not rooted, you will need to root it using tools like Magisk or SuperSU. Ensure you are aware of the potential risks and benefits.
- Install a Modding App: Applications like "WA Tweaks" or "WhatsApp Mods" can be found on repositories such as GitHub or XDA Developers. Download and install one of these apps.
- Apply the Changes: Open the modding app, find the option to change checkmark colors, and select your preferred color. Apply the changes, and restart WhatsApp if necessary.

Important Considerations:
- Security Risks: Jailbreaking or rooting your device can expose it to security vulnerabilities. Always ensure you download tweaks and mods from trusted sources.
- Updates: Be aware that WhatsApp updates may overwrite any customizations made by third-party apps. You might need to reapply the changes after each update.
- Support: Official support for these modifications is not provided by WhatsApp, so use them at your own risk.
